    I have a 2014 Tundra that’s been intermittently turning on the traction control light for the past 6-8 months. Now the light is on constantly. Truck drives perfectly fine with the exception that I do not have traction control and will spin the tires when trying to accelerate aggressively in the rain. I do believe the ABS is still working properly since I had to brake very hard the other day and I believe I felt it engage.


    Code that’s coming up is C1267 which is specific for a malfunction in the brake pedal load sensing switch. At least that’s what I’ve been told. Just took it to one mechanic who said that this switch is one of the two sensors located in the brake booster but the only way to fix it is to replace the entire brake booster assembly. Took it to the Toyota dealer for a second opinion and now they recommend that I replace the brake booster assembly and the pump actuator assembly. I’m not sure who to believe but I know I don’t have $4,600 to fix this. Especially when the truck is driving just fine. I can’t find anybody else online who is having this specific issue where this is the only light that’s on and nothing else. Anybody that can offer some help will be greatly appreciated.
